BURGER KING CORP.: has teamed up with The Inventure Group, Inc. to add Onion Ring flavored snacks to its line of Burger King salted snacks. The new product joins the potato snack flavors of the company’s Ketchup & Fries and Flamed Broiled products. All three snacks are available in a variety of sizes and price points in vending machines, convenience stores, warehouse clubs, drug and grocery stores. Onion Rings are available in single serving sizes in vending machines, two-ounce bags at convenience stores and three-ounce bags in grocery stores. Larger sizes and variety packs will be available in clubs stores this fall. The companies also announced the expansion of the snack food license to international markets including Caribbean, Mexico, Central America, South America, India, Hong Kong, Thailand, Taiwan and the Philippines.

FORRESTER RESEARCH: has named Dwight Griesman as its new chief marketing officer. In his new role, Griesman will drive Forrester’s brand and marketing initiatives and communicate Forrester’s offerings to IT, marketing and technology industry leaders. He joined Forrester more than three years ago to build the company’s leadership boards marketing programs. Prior to joining Forrester, he was the managing director of The Forbes Consulting Group’s Quantitative Analytics division, providing custom research and consulting services to Fortune 1000 clients.
